Abstract

The utility model discloses an automatic dip soldering machine, including dip -soldering machine, dip -soldering control mechanism, power unit, work piece chuck, dip -soldering control mechanism be connected with power unit, the work piece chuck be connected with power unit, the work piece chuck on be equipped with a plurality of clamping machine hands and centre gripping control mechanism, the clamping machine hand be connected with centre gripping control mechanism. The utility model discloses it does not need the workman to carry out the whole journey operation man -hour to add simultaneously, has reduced manpower consumption, the cost is reduced. Simultaneously set up a plurality of clamping machine hands and centre gripping control mechanism on the work piece chuck, increased the work piece quantity that the dip -soldering machine was operated at every turn, provide production efficiency.

Background technology
Dip-soldering machine of the prior art is typically made up of immersed solder pond and operating mechanism, and wherein operating mechanism will pass through people's industry control System switch Jing workpiece immersion and take out, artificial operation can cause time error, cause simultaneously the immersion process time of workpiece with it is pre- If it is inconsistent, and workpiece immersion and the speed taken out also is difficult to keep uniform, finally makes the uneven thickness of workpiece dip brazing tin It is even, the reduction of workpiece quality is caused, affect workpiece performance.And, existing dip-soldering machine once can only one workpiece of immersed solder, affect Production efficiency.
To avoid manually-operated error, it is desirable to provide it is a kind of once can the multiple workpiece of immersed solder automatic dip-soldering machine.
